Monthly Cost of Living

A single person spends $2,848 per month in Hong Kong vs $1,031 in Medellin, rent included.

A couple spends around $4,336 per month in Hong Kong vs $1,599 in Medellin, rent included.

A family of three spends $5,823 per month in Hong Kong vs $2,167 in Medellin, rent included.

Hong Kong costs about 176% more than Medellin, driven mainly by Groceries & Markets.

Hong Kong sits 113% above the global median, while Medellin is 23% below – they fall on opposite sides of the world average.

Cost Breakdown

A central one-bedroom costs $2,160 in Hong Kong versus $477 in Medellin. Rent is usually the largest line item in a monthly budget, so the gap here sets the tone for the overall comparison.

Salaries run about 424% higher in Hong Kong, which partly offsets the higher cost of living there. Purchasing power depends on which expenses matter most to you.

A mid-range dinner for two costs $64.0 in Hong Kong versus $33.00 in Medellin. Monthly groceries follow the same trend: $417 vs $193 – making Medellin the more affordable choice for daily food spending.
